The Route: A Little Bit of Everything
The itinerary is designed to be relaxed and scenic. You’ll first cruise around Werdersee Island, a peaceful retreat with well-maintained paths ideal for beginners. The tour then crosses the Weser River multiple times, giving you a taste of Bremen’s picturesque riverfront scenery and urban charm.
Throughout the journey, your guide shares snippets about the sights, but the emphasis isn’t on an exhaustive city tour. Instead, it’s about getting to know the unique sensation of riding a Segway and enjoying beautiful surroundings. We particularly enjoyed riding up bridges and narrow footpaths, which added a touch of adventure without feeling stressful.
Stops and Rest Breaks
While the ride is mostly continuous, there are short stops for rest and photos—perfect opportunities to soak in the views and catch your breath. If the group agrees, you might even take a sit break at a local beer garden or ice cream parlor, which adds a charming local flavor to your day.

Who Should Consider This Tour?
This experience is ideal for groups of friends, families (over 14 years old), bachelor parties, or corporate team-building. It’s not suitable for children under 14, pregnant women, wheelchair users, or those with certain health conditions like vertigo or epilepsy. The activity requires participants to be between 88 lbs (40 kg) and 260 lbs (118 kg) and taller than 4 ft 6 in (140 cm).

Frequently Asked Questions
How long is the tour?
The tour lasts approximately 3 hours, including training, riding, and breaks.
Is it suitable for beginners?
Yes, the thorough training ensures even first-time Segway riders can enjoy the experience confidently.
Are helmets provided?
Yes, helmets are available and included in the price, though you can bring your own if preferred.
Can I book a specific start time?
Absolutely, the tour offers individual tour dates and start times to fit your schedule.
What happens in case of bad weather?
If weather conditions make riding unsafe, the tour will be canceled, and you can reschedule or get a refund.
Is there an insurance option?
Yes, an optional comprehensive insurance with a $250 deductible is available for an extra $5 per person.
Are there any age or health restrictions?
The tour is not suitable for children under 14, pregnant women, wheelchair users, or those with conditions like vertigo, epilepsy, or very low/high weight.
What should I wear?
Dress appropriately for the weather, avoid high heels, and consider sunglasses or gloves if the weather is hot or cold.
